Automated imaging for advanced particle characterization
Morphological imaging is fast becoming an essential technology in the laboratory toolkit for particle characterization. The Morphologi 4 is a fully automated static image analysis system which provides a complete detailed description of the morphological properties of particulate materials. The Morphologi 4-ID uses Morphologically-Directed Raman Spectroscopy (MDRS), which combines automated static image analysis and Raman spectroscopy in a single, integrated platform. This enables component-specific particle size and shape characterisation of the chemical species within a blend.
